Community engagement is crucial for controlling disease outbreak and mitigating natural and industrial disasters. The COVID-19 pandemic has reconfirmed the need to elevate community engagement to build equity, trust and sustained action in future health promotion preparedness strategies. Using the health promotion strategy of strengthening community action enhances the opportunity for better outcomes. There is, therefore, a need to improve our understanding of community engagement practices during crises, scale-up good community engagement initiatives, and improve and sustain people-centered approaches to emergency responses. This paper presents five case studies from the United States, Singapore, Sierra Leone, Kenya and South Africa that demonstrate the potential strengths that can be nurtured to build resilience in local communities to help mitigate the impact of disasters and emergencies. The case studies highlight the importance of co-developing relevant education and communication strategies, amplifying the role of community leaders, empowering community members to achieve shared goals, assessing and adapting to changing contexts, pre-planning and readiness for future emergencies and acknowledgement of historic context.

The Sierra Leone Trial to Introduce a Vaccine against Ebola (STRIVE), a phase 2/3 trial of investigational rVSV∆G-ZEBOV-GP vaccine, was conducted during an unprecedented Ebola epidemic. More than 8600 eligible healthcare and frontline response workers were individually randomized to immediate (within 7 days) or deferred (within 18-24 weeks) vaccination and followed for 6 months after vaccination for serious adverse events and Ebola virus infection. Key challenges included limited infrastructure to support trial activities, unreliable electricity, and staff with limited clinical trial experience. Study staff made substantial infrastructure investments, including renovation of enrollment sites, laboratories, and government cold chain facilities, and imported equipment to store and transport vaccine at ≤-60oC. STRIVE built capacity by providing didactic and practical research training to >350 staff, which was reinforced with daily review and feedback meetings. The operational challenges of safety follow-up were addressed by issuing mobile telephones to participants, making home visits, and establishing a nurse triage hotline. Before the Ebola outbreak, Sierra Leone had limited infrastructure and staff to conduct clinical trials. Without interfering with the outbreak response, STRIVE responded to an urgent need and helped build this capacity. BACKGROUND: Little attention has been paid to potential relationships between mental health, trauma, and personal exposures to Ebola virus disease (EVD) and health behaviors in post-conflict West Africa. We tested a conceptual model linking mental health and trauma to EVD risk behaviors and EVD prevention behaviors. METHODS AND FINDINGS: Using survey data from a representative sample in the Western Urban and Western Rural districts of Sierra Leone, this study examines associations between war exposures, post-traumatic stress disorder (PTSD) symptoms, depression, anxiety, and personal EVD exposure (e.g., having family members or friends diagnosed with EVD) and EVD-related health behaviors among 1,008 adults (98% response rate) from 63 census enumeration areas of the Western Rural and Western Urban districts randomly sampled at the height of the EVD epidemic (January-April 2015). Primary outcomes were EVD risk behaviors (14 items, Cronbach's α = 0.84) and EVD prevention behaviors (16 items, Cronbach's α = 0.88). Main predictors comprised war exposures (8 items, Cronbach's α = 0.85), anxiety (10 items, Cronbach's α = 0.93), depression (15 items, Cronbach's α = 0.91), and PTSD symptoms (16 items, Cronbach's α = 0.93). Data were analyzed using two-level, population-weighted hierarchical linear models with 20 multiply imputed datasets. EVD risk behaviors were associated with intensity of depression symptoms (b = 0.05; 95% CI 0.00, 0.10; p = 0.037), PTSD symptoms (b = 0.10; 95% CI 0.03, 0.17; p = 0.008), having a friend diagnosed with EVD (b = -0.04; 95% CI -0.08, -0.00; p = 0.036), and war exposures (b = -0.09; 95% CI -0.17, -0.02; p = 0.013). EVD prevention behaviors were associated with higher anxiety (b = 0.23; 95% CI 0.06, 0.40; p = 0.008), having a friend diagnosed with EVD (b = 0.15; 95% CI 0.04, 0.27; p = 0.011), and higher levels of war exposure (b = 0.45; 95% CI 0.16, 0.74; p = 0.003), independent of mental health. PTSD symptoms were associated with lower levels of EVD prevention behavior (b = -0.24; 95% CI -0.43, -0.06; p = 0.009). CONCLUSIONS: In post-conflict settings, past war trauma and mental health problems are associated with health behaviors related to combatting EVD. The associations between war trauma and both EVD risk behaviors and EVD prevention behaviors may be mediated through two key mental health variables: depression and PTSD symptoms. Considering the role of mental health in the prevention of disease transmission may help fight continuing and future Ebola outbreaks in post-conflict Sierra Leone. This sample is specific to Freetown and the Western Area and may not be representative of all of Sierra Leone. In addition, our main outcomes as well as personal EVD exposure, war exposures, and mental health predictors rely on self-report, and therefore raise the possibility of common methods bias. However, the findings of this study may be relevant for understanding dynamics related to EVD and mental health in other major capital cities in the EVD-affected countries of West Africa.
